An aversion to urban density and all that it contributes to urban life, and a perception that the city was the place where "big government" first took root in America fostered what historian Steven Conn terms the "anti-urban impulse." In this provocative and sweeping audiobook, Conn explores the anti-urban impulse across the 20th century, examining how the ideas born of it have shaped both the places in which Americans live and work, and the anti-government politics so strong today.

Really enjoyed this book to the point of thinking of assigning it to my students in planning. Lots of good insight in an engaged format.
Narrator was generally good with two cringeworthy mispronunciations: Pruitt-Igoe (I not E sound) and W.E.B. DuBois (NOT a French “doobwah” pronunciation). Those were absolutely jarring and took me out of the story. It’s sad it wasn’t caught and fixed since the likely audience for the book will be familiar with both.
